當前位置:
首頁 >
ProE常用曲线方程:Python Matplotlib 版本代码(玫瑰曲线)
發布時間:2023/12/31
35
豆豆
生活随笔
收集整理的這篇文章主要介紹了
ProE常用曲线方程:Python Matplotlib 版本代码(玫瑰曲线)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
Pyplot教程:https://matplotlib.org/gallery/index.html#pyplots-examples?
玫瑰曲線
文字描述
平面內,圍繞某一中心點平均分布整數個正弦花瓣的曲線.數學描述
在極坐標下可表示為ρ=a*sin(nθ),a為定長,n為整數.圖形描述
在極坐標系中,以下方程表示的曲線稱為玫瑰曲線: r = sin ( k θ ) 或 r = cos ( k θ ) 當 k 是奇數時,玫瑰曲線有 k 個花瓣;當 k 是偶數時,玫瑰曲線有 2k 個花瓣。執行效果如下圖:Python代碼: def drawFlowers():theta=np.arange(0,2*np.pi,0.02); plt.subplot(111,polar=True);plt.plot(theta,np.cos(6*theta),'-',lw=2);#6瓣花瓣plt.plot(theta,np.cos(5*theta),'--',lw=2);#5瓣花瓣plt.plot(theta,2*np.cos(4*theta),lw=2);#4瓣花瓣plt.rgrids(np.arange(0.5,2,0.5),angle=45); plt.thetagrids([0,45,90]);plt.show();
玫瑰曲線:
總結
以上是生活随笔為你收集整理的ProE常用曲线方程:Python Matplotlib 版本代码(玫瑰曲线)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: ESP8266软件篇-esp8266编程
- 下一篇: Caffe2:python -m caf